Dali Railway Station Guides
Opened in 1999, Dali Railway Station (Chinese name 大理站, Dali Zhan) is located 3km south of Dali downtown, and 18km southeast of Dali Ancient City. In the past, this station mainly served traditional trains. On July 01 2018, Dali Railway Station began to serve bullet trains. In Jan 2019, the station's renovation was finished. New facilities are included 2 elevators, 4 lifts and E-ticket check-in Kiosks . Dali railway station covers 3,400 square metre, and has 3 platforms, 10 railway tracks. Dali Railway Station is mainly serving 25 high-speed trains and bullet trains, including dali - Chuxiong - Dali - Lijiang intercity rail, Guangzhou to Dali, Guilin to Dali, Guiyang to Dali and Nanning to Dali high-speed trains.
Dali Railway Station has 3 floors. The entrance, exits and ticket offices are on 1F. Departures hall (Waiting rooms) are on 2F and 3F. The platforms are on 2F
3F Level | Bullet train's Waiting Rooms, Business Loungae, Platforms |
2F Level | Waiting Room, Platforms |
1F Level | Entrance, Security Check, Ticket office, Arrivals, Exits, Pick-up and Drop-off area, Parking lots, bus station |

Public Transportation
The public transports are included city bus and taxi. Taxi is mostly recommended. How to get to Dali Railway Station?
Taxi
Taxi is one convenient and fast, but also the most expensive way to get to or leave Dali Railway Station.
Taxi drop-off and pick-up area: the exits gate on 1F
The one way fare from Dali Railway Station to Dali Ancient city is around RMB55, around 35 minutes.

Bus
There are 9 bus routes to or pass Dali Railway Station, including Bus line 8 from Dali Railway Station to Dali Ancient City, Airport bus from Dali Railway Station to Dali Airport. The bus station is A district on east parking lots. The bus ticket fare is RMB3 - RMB10.

Departures
Step 1: Get to Dali Railway Station by Taxi, bus or Car.
Step 2: At entrance, go through Security Check and real-name ID check to enter departure Hall by showing passport.
Step 3: Take the elevators or lifts to Waiting Room. Find the Boarding Gate (Ticket Check Gate). The gate No. will be in the confirmation email we send to you.
Step 4: Have a seat near the gate to wait for check-in and boarding. The boarding gate will be opened 20 - 15 minutes prior to the departure time.
Step 5: Ticket check. Please show your passport and confirmation No. to station staff to check in. The boarding gate will be closed 5 minutes before the train departs
Step 6: Find the platform of your train.

Do you need to collect train tickets?
Since Dec 2019, the electronic tickets have been available on most high-speed and bullet train routes from or to Dali Railway Station.
It means international travellers can show their passports, likes Chinese ID to check in and board the train directly, and don't need to collect the printed tickets at ticket office.
